I'll be honest. 1st off I live in Steilacoom and my back yard fence literally touches Ft. Lewis. but I am over at WSU on the other side of the state. Ft. Lewis doesn't have much of anything to offer in the way of DH. I would know man, I've scouted that whole area and there isn't anything out there. I've built stuff but it's all gotten torn down or bulldozed. You should check with Bike Tech in Olympia. I used to work @ Bike Tech Tacoma. Justin in Olympia actually has a DH/FR club that rides on Sundays in Capitol Forest. That's one of your best options. Hopefully you can find something down there.
